SOIL SYSTEMS GUIDE
Abstract: This publication covers basic soil properties and management steps toward building and maintaining
healthy soils.
Part I deals with basic soil principles and provides an understanding of living soils and how they work.
In this section you will find answers to why soil organisms and organic matter are important.
Part II covers management steps to build soil quality on your farm.
